St. Luke's Clinic – Urogynecology

Our team provides the latest, most advanced care for women experiencing pelvic floor, bladder, or sexual function problems including urinary incontinence and retention, overactive bladder, pelvic organ prolapse, neurogenic bladder, and other disorders.

    Jennifer Lillemon, MD treats a wide array of female pelvic floor disorders, including pelvic organ prolapse, urinary incontinence, urinary retention, overactive bladder, genitourinary syndrome of menopause, and recurrent urinary tract infections. She performs a variety of clinic-based procedures such as urethral bulking, bladder Botox®, cystoscopy, complex multichannel urodynamic testing, and pessary fitting. She is trained in the full range of surgical and non-surgical approaches to pelvic floor disorders. Dr. Lillemon's expertise also includes robotic surgery for pelvic organ prolapse (sacrocolpopexy), hysterectomy, and fistula repair procedures.
